The Opportunity We are seeking a seasoned B2B Marketing Director to join our in-house marketing team who will have the opportunity to own responsibility for the corporate Meriton brand as well as work across a wide variety of operating brands, mediums, channels, and project types. This is a unique opportunity to become part of a group that is passionate about great work, telling compelling stories and creating thoughtful experiences for a dynamic company. A successful candidate will serve as an integral leader of our marketing team and should have experience managing fast-paced, dynamic teams and delivering on integrated marketing and communications priorities (in-house or agency) for multiple brands/accounts at a time. The Marketing Director is responsible for working closely with our Meriton leadership, marketing managers, operating company leaders and brands to develop and execute targeted marketing strategies that enhance brand presence and drive sales within assigned regions. This role entails close collaboration with local sales teams, hands-on execution of day-to-day marketing requests, event and social media management, management of strategic campaigns and projects with our in-house creative agency team, and direct oversight and management of the internal marketing team. Responsibilities Strategy and planning Collaborate with OpCo’s and Marketing Managers to develop and implement annual and long-term marketing strategies Conduct market research and competitor analysis to identify trends and opportunities Create and manage annual marketing plans and budgets Collaborate with leadership to align marketing with overall business goals Campaign management and execution Oversee the creation and execution of marketing campaigns across various channels (digital, social media, email, etc.) Manage brand awareness, product launches, and promotional events Collaborate with Comms team to develop content marketing strategies Ensure marketing and communications materials maintain a consistent brand image Team leadership Lead, manage, and mentor the Meriton marketing team Develop and nurture business partner/trusted advisor relationship with OpCo leaders and Meriton executive team Foster a culture of high performance within the team Analytics and reporting Establish and track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) Analyze campaign performance and use data to inform future initiatives Measure return on investment (ROI) and report on the efficiency of marketing activities Collaboration and communication Collaborate with other departments, especially sales and shared services, to ensure strategy alignment Build and maintain relationships with external partners, media, and stakeholders Communicate marketing goals and strategies effectively within the team and the wider business The Profile 10+ years of hands-on marketing management experience in a corporate or agency setting – B2B experience preferred BA in marketing, communications, or journalism Works with a high degree of independence and is a self-starter Comfortable collaborating across all levels of an organization – from advising senior leaders to directly overseeing junior team members; previous people management experience preferred Strong writing, editing, and proofreading skills Strong skill set working in Office Suite: PPT, Word, Excel Previous hands-on experience leading rebrand strategy development and brand rollout/deployment initiatives across complex corporate brands and businesses Proven experience developing and executing marketing strategies and plans, establishing budgets and measurable KPIs Experience in planning and developing content for internal communications channels including intranets, newsletters, town hall meetings, etc. Experience planning and executing company hosted events, customer appreciation events, employee events and other experiential marketing initiatives Ability to work with provided design templates to create on-brand collateral like flyers, presentations, posters, etc.; graphic design experience and/or experience with Adobe Creative Suite applications a plus Excellent project management and organization skills 5+ years managing teams of marketing professionals and driving team culture and positive group dynamic in a fast-paged, evolving environment Role does require some degree of travel for meetings with teammates across the network Other Skills/Abilities Strategic Skills Ability to keep up with current trends in communications, technologies and marketing strategies as well as competitive positioning and target mindset.
